I'm sure I'll get lynched for this, but I have no qualms downloading music or games from the internet --- especially if the item is next to impossible to get otherwise. Seriously, am I going to cruise Ebay for an obsure Commodore 64 title, or some old dos game that the publisher admits that they'll never remake? In my opinion, it doesn't matter if you buy something used vs. downloading it -- the original company doesn't get money in either case. If you follow the book industry, publishers HATE used book-stores, because they don't get a cut. So if we're talking about respecting copyright, etc., almost everyone, every day breaks it.

I'm a big fan of free information, and our culture is geared toward copying things. We have copiers for paper, vcr's and dvd-r's for movies, internet for mp3's and games. We'd have to have a serious shift in doing business with just about everything to change that.

I should end by saying that I do think it is good not to host a rom site yourself or link to one, and I also think it is good to observe the rules on forums such as this one, and not broadcast roms, etc. I just wanted to give my own justifications for why I think rom dumping, etc., is okay (though obviously not legal -- but I guess you can see that I don't really respect current copyright law). I also wanted to say that I would be very, very surprised if most of use didn't download roms or music of some type -- especially all us emulator freaks.
